A glucose meter is a portable electronic device designed for the quick and convenient measurement of blood glucose levels. Primarily used by individuals with diabetes to monitor their blood sugar regularly, these compact meters provide a means for self-testing without the need for laboratory analysis. The process involves pricking a small sample of blood, usually obtained from a fingertip, and applying it to a disposable test strip. The glucose meter then quantifies the blood glucose concentration by detecting the chemical reaction between the glucose in the blood sample and reagents on the test strip. The meter displays the results in units of milligrams per deciliter (mg/dL) or millimoles per liter (mmol/L), offering immediate feedback on blood sugar levels. The widespread availability and ease of use of glucose meters have significantly contributed to the self-management of diabetes, allowing individuals to make informed decisions about their diet, medication, and lifestyle based on real-time glucose measurements.
